Mental illness can look like a lot of things, such as depression, bipolar disorder, or substance use disorder. Actually, these are some of the most prevalent conditions Americans face. Mental illness is defined as the presence of health conditions involving changes in emotions, thoughts, and behavior. The presence of mental illness may be identified by distress or issues in social settings, work, and family relationships. Diagnosing and treating mental illnesses is possible, but must be done by trained and experienced mental health providers in Campbell, TX such as psychiatrists, psychologists, and mental health counselors. Treatment varies but may include a combination of behavioral therapy, support group meetings, and life skills development.

Mental Health in Campbell, TX - What is Mental Health

Mental health is defined as the condition of our emotional, cognitive, and behavioral well-being. Simply put: It’s the state of our minds. It can impact everything from how we think and feel, to how we act and how our bodies respond to certain situations and stimuli.

Our mental health can have a major impact on our overall quality of life. Our relationships, careers, and finances can all suffer. It effects our self-esteem, influences how we make choices, our ability to communicate, and even our learning capabilities.

Even though we cannot actually see or measure it, our mental health determines how we interact with the world around us. How our minds operate, ultimately determined who we are as individuals.

Types of Mental Health Providers in Campbell, TX

A mental illness can manifest itself in various ways, ranging from disruptive thoughts to physical manifestations and the intensity can range from mild to severe. To address the wide spectrum of mental illnesses, there are different care providers who can provide various types of treatment. Let’s consider each option:

Psychologists in Campbell

A psychologist is a mental health professional who is qualified to conduct psychological evaluations and issue diagnoses. During a therapy session with a psychiatrist, you can expect to work on identifying negative thoughts and emotions and developing coping mechanisms to manage them. Much of their practice zeros in on addressing and resolving destructive and otherwise unhealthy behaviors.

Psychiatrists in Campbell

Sometimes an individual needs more immediate or intense treatment compared to what a psychologist can offer - namely prescription medication. Psychiatrists are physicians (medical doctors) who specialize in mental illness and therefore can offer prescription medication. Even though, they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), not all psychiatrists do.

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Campbell

All are interchangeable terms used to describe mental health care professionals with a masters-level education in in a field related to mental or public health. They function more like psychologists than psychiatrists, being treatment-focused often with an emphasis on modifying behavior. More often than not, behavioral therapy is the primary treatment option.

Paying for Campbell Mental Health Rehab

Nothing in life is free, and mental healthcare is no exception. The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Here is an overview of all of the options in terms of paying for mental healthcare:

  • Private Insurance might be offered through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. You can also sign up for your own private insurance plan directly through a private insurance provider.
  • Subsidized Private Insurance is available through healthcare.gov to those who have a low income, yet do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
  •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
  •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
  • Out-of-pocket] - Those who have the financial means may pay for their mental health rehab Campbell out-of-pocket. Payment plans and credit options may be available for self-pay clients.
  • Scholarships - Occasionally, mental health rehab centers Campbell offer a scholarship for individuals who express a great want and dedication to getting better, but otherwise would not have the means.
  • “Free” Programs - Certain organizations allocate funds to provide mental health treatment to lower income individuals in their community. Unfortunately, there may be a long waiting period in areas with high demand for these services.
